Measuring mental workload with the NASA-TLX needs to examine each dimension rather than relying on the global score: An example with driving

Résumé

The distinction between several components of mental workload is often made in the ergonomics literature. However, measurements used are often established from a global score, notably with several questionnaires that originally reflect several dimensions. The present study tested the effect of driving situation complexity, experience and subjective levels of tension and alertness on each dimension of the NASA-TLX questionnaire of workload, in order to highlight the potential influence of intrinsic, extraneous and germane load factors. The results showed that, in complex situation, mental, temporal and physical demand (load dimensions) increased, and that novice drivers presented high physical demand when subjective tension was low and low own performance. Moreover, increase of mental and physical demand increased effort. It thus appears essential to distinguish the different components of mental workload used in the NASA-TLX questionnaire
